Abstract: Five energetic transition metal salts based on H2DNAMT were synthesized. Meanwhile, H2DNAMT was oxidized to H2BNATO due to Fe3+ in [Fe(BNATO)(H2O)4]·2H2O. All of the metal salts exhibit comparable thermal stability and insensitivity.

Abstract: Only lithium cations among the metals of the IA group caused a blue-shift of solid-state photoluminescence of alkali metal salts of a tetracyanopyridine derivative due to the special features of the crystal packing.
